Optical System Design of Airship Multispectral Camera Based on LCTF

    Optical system design of multispectral camera based on liquid crystal tunable filter(LCTF) was presented. The optical system has a focal length of 60 mm, F number is 3.5, spectrum band is 400~720 nm, and the field angle is 16.6°. It consisted of the fore-optical system and the subsequent imaging system, the fore-optical system was adopted in order to attain beam of light which can fulfill requirement of the aperture and field angle of LCTF, the double Gaussian structure was adopted in the subsequent imaging system. The imaging analysis results show that the design fulfills operating and engineering requirement. The optical system can produce a clear image in 16 waveband of the spectral range.
